Petit larceny is a class one (1) misdemeanor whose punishment include a jail term not exceeding twelve (12) months, a fine not exceeding two thousand five hundred (2, 500) dollars, or both the fines and jail term. If you committed the offense under pressure from another person, with threats of death or bodily injury, your attorney could claim that you acted under duress. Va. 2-95 defines grand larceny as theft of property valued at $5 or more if taken from a person or $1, 000 or more if not taken from a person. The name refers to many plants in the alocasia family, but all can be characterized by their huge, heart-shaped leaves atop slender stems.
